Inadequate Flashing Installment
Choosing the right materials isn't the only variable that can result in roofing issues; poor blinking installment can likewise produce significant issues. Flashing is crucial for guiding water far from at risk areas, such as smokeshafts, skylights, and roofing valleys. If it's not installed properly, you risk water breach, which can lead to mold and mildew development and architectural damages.
When you set up blinking, ensure it's the ideal kind for your roof's design and the neighborhood environment. For instance, metal flashing is commonly a lot more long lasting than plastic in areas with heavy rain or snow. See to it the blinking overlaps appropriately and is protected tightly to stop voids where water can leak through.
You must also take notice of the installment angle. Blinking must be positioned to direct water away from your house, not toward it.
If you're uncertain about the installment procedure or the products required, seek advice from an expert. They can help recognize the very best flashing choices and guarantee everything is installed appropriately, guarding your home from prospective water damage.

Neglecting Ventilation Demands
While lots of property owners concentrate on the visual and structural facets of roofing installment, neglecting air flow needs can bring about severe long-term consequences. Correct ventilation is vital for controling temperature level and dampness degrees in your attic room, preventing issues like mold development, timber rot, and ice dams. If you don't install sufficient ventilation, you're setting your roofing system up for failure.
To prevent this error, first, assess your home's specific air flow needs. This combination allows hot air to escape while cooler air gets in, keeping your attic area comfortable.
Also, think about the sort of roof covering product you have actually picked. Some products might need extra ventilation methods. Ascertain your regional building ordinance for ventilation standards, as they can differ substantially.
Finally, don't fail to remember to check your air flow system routinely. Obstructions from debris or insulation can hamper air movement, so maintain those vents clear.
